What to Look For in a Christmas Tree with Lights

When choosing the perfect Christmas tree with lights, you should keep a few factors in mind. Firstly, consider the height of your room and whether you have enough space for a 4 ft tree. You want your tree to be the centerpiece of your home, not a hindrance.

Next, think about the type of lights you want on your tree. LED lights are energy-efficient, durable, and long-lasting. On the other hand, incandescent lights are warmer and have a more natural hue. Whichever you choose, make sure the lights are evenly distributed and come with a reliable warranty.

Finally, think about the tree itself. A full-bodied tree with a sturdy base is ideal but also look for a tree with branches that can support your ornaments without drooping. A tree made from fire-resistant materials is also an intelligent choice.
